What does Larsa mean and where does it come from?
Larsa has roots in ancient Mesopotamia as a city-state and has been a part of Middle Eastern history. It is reflected in archaeological findings and records dating back to 2000 BC. In modern times, it's less common as a personal name but maintains cultural significance.

The story of Larsa
Larsa is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 2011. With 24 total births recorded, Larsa remains relatively uncommon.
